1993 soundtrack album by Various artists
The Short Cuts Soundtrack was released in 1993 as the
soundtrack album for the film
Short Cuts . The album was released by the
Imago Recording Company.
Several well-known musicians provided material for this album, including
Bono and
The Edge from
U2 ,
Elvis Costello and
Iggy Pop .
Michael Stipe from
R.E.M. makes a guest vocal appearance on one track.
Most of the songs are performed by
jazz singer
Annie Ross , who appears in the film. Actress
Lori Singer performs
cello on three classical compositions.

The Low Note Quintet consisted of Bruce Fowler on trombone, Terry Adams on piano, Gene Estes on the vibes,
Greg Cohen on bass, and
Bobby Previte on drums.
The Trout Quartet consisted of
Stuart Kanin on violin,
Anatoly Rosinsky on violin,
Roland Kato on viola, and
Armen Guzelimian on piano.
Other musicians:
Iggy Pop: vocals on "Evil California"
Michael Stipe: vocals on "Full Moon"
Steven Bernstein : trumpet on "To Hell With Love" and "Full Moon"
David Tronzo : slide guitar on "To Hell With Love", "Full Moon" and "I Don't Know You"
Anthony Coleman : clavinet on "Evil California"
Lenny Pickett : woodwinds on "Prisoner Of Life/I'm Gonna Go Fishin'"
Produced by
Hal Willner . Recorded and mixed by
Eric Liljestrand , except the Dvořák and Herbert tracks (mixed by
Tom Lazarus ), "Evil California" (mixed by
Kevin Killen ), Stravinsky's "Berceuse" (recorded and mixed by Tom Lazarus), "So Quickly" (produced by Thomas Tree, Cory Coppage and Michael Pfeiffer; recorded and mixed by Michael Pfeiffer) and "Full Moon" (recorded by
John Keane ).
